Hilton Head healthcare

A local hospital and county EMS support care, while specialty and mainland routes still need confirmation

Novant Health Hilton Head Medical Center lists 24 hour emergency services, imaging, heart and vascular care, orthopedics, rehabilitation, stroke, surgery, and other services. Beaufort County EMS transports patients to Hilton Head, Coastal Carolina, and Beaufort Memorial hospitals. The catalog records one mapped hospital nearby, 109 reported beds, 16 selected specialists, five likely primary care sites within 15 miles, and six pharmacies.

Map the hospital, primary care, pharmacy, groceries, rehabilitation, a likely specialist, mainland hospitals, parking, traffic, weather routes, evacuation, and home return. Ask which needs stay on the island, which move to Bluffton or Beaufort, and who helps after discharge.

Hilton Head Island in everyday life

Could Hilton Head Island work for you?

What may work well

  • The local hospital publishes a broad emergency and specialty service list.
  • County EMS, hospital, specialist, primary care, and pharmacy measures give the household a clear island and mainland map to verify.

What to think about

  • Facility lists and counts do not settle every physician, wait, cost, coverage, referral, transfer, or aftercare arrangement.
  • Storms, traffic, bridge access, parking, heat, and mainland travel can affect recovery.

Review Hilton Head care

  1. List current needs

    Write down doctors, medicines, diagnostics, therapy, emergency preferences, insurance, referrals, and likely future support.

  2. Confirm the network

    Check Hilton Head Medical Center, current specialists, primary care, prescriptions, referrals, transfers, rehabilitation, mainland transport, traffic, and insurance.

  3. Plan aftercare

    Identify rides, meals, home help, mobility support, air conditioning, power backup, flood and evacuation plans, and follow up.
